Print return address on envelope
I am trying to print a return address on a #10 envelope. I have set the top and left margins to 0, but it still wants to print 1.5 inches from the edge of the envelope. What can I do to get the return address to print in the proper place? |

My first inclination would be to advise against using a spreadsheet program as a word processor.
Otherwise, go to the Page Layout tab. Under Margins, select Custom. Make sure the Top and Left margins are zero. Lastly, set the Header margin to zero. |

You may also find that setting your top margin to 0 although that should move it to the top that your printer may not be physically capable of printing that close to the edge of envelope. The rollers inside the printer which move the paper or envelope through need an area they can grab at the ends of the paper to keep it straight so the print heads may not be able to reach right to the edge.

Tried all of the things mentioned and none of them worked. I called CANON and was told that it was the printer that restricted the print area. However, I reconfigured my file and printed from a different orientation and got it to work.
